They would have to have the bowls and lenses replaced. All 1st, 2nd, and 3rd gens are designed for halogen, the ones you posted are 4th gen and I think those are designed for halogens as well.

My 1st gens came with halogen bulbs mounted and had a sticker specifying that they were not for use with HIDs. When I eventually mounted HIDs in them the beam pattern had hotspots and dark lines. Stock housings with regular bulbs was brighter and more even.
